Your site type will become clear as it is evaluated using Table 2-6 for other characteristics related to transaction complexity, volume swings, data volatility, security, and so on.
If the application has further characteristics that could potentially affect its scalability, then add the extra characteristics to Table 2-6.
All site types are considered to have high volumes of dynamic transactions.
| Workload characteristics | Publish / Subscribe | Online shopping | Customer self- service | Online trading | Business to business |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| High volume, dynamic, transactional, fast growth | Yes | Yes | Yes | Yes | Yes |
| Volume of user-specific responses | Low | Low | Medium | High | Medium |
| Amount of cross-session information | Low | High | High | High | High |
| Volume of dynamic searches | Low | High | Low | Low | Medium |
| Transaction complexity | Low | Medium | High | High | High |
| Transaction volume swing | Low | Medium | Medium | High | High |
| Data volatility | Low | Low | Low | High | Medium |
| Number of unique items | High | Medium | Low | Medium | Medium |
| Number of page views | High | Medium | Low | Medium | Medium |
| Percent secure pages (privacy) | Low | Medium | Medium | High | High |
| Use of security (authentication, integrity, non-repudiation) | Low | High | High | High | High |
